A decade-long campaign to bring in safety measures on a road in Oldham where parents 'live in fear or their kids' has finally succeeded.
Under Lane, which connects the Saddleworth village of Grotton to Mossley via Lees road, has long caused anxiety because of daily speeding incidents.
Councillors have struggled to secure funding to introduce a new speed limit or enforcement measures. But earlier this month, a long-running campaign was rewarded with the placement of a rumble strip to alert drivers to their speed.
